#18d8bc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#18d8bc is composed of 9.4% red, 84.7%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 13%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 171.3 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 47.1%. #18d8bc color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#00b179.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#18d8bc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#18d8bc has RGB values of R:24, G:216,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.13,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 1628348.

Hex triplet 18d8bc #18d8bc
RGB Decimal 24, 216, 188 rgb(24,216,188)
RGB Percent 9.4, 84.7, 73.7 rgb(9.4%,84.7%,73.7%)
CMYK 89, 0, 13, 15
HSL 171.3°, 80, 47.1 hsl(171.3,80%,47.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 171.3°, 88.9, 84.7
Web Safe 00cccc #00cccc
CIE-LAB 77.836, -49.505, 1.546
XYZ 34.006, 52.933, 55.999
xyY 0.238, 0.37, 52.933
CIE-LCH 77.836, 49.529, 178.212
CIE-LUV 77.836, -61.995, 10.093
Hunter-Lab 72.755, -43.889, 5.294
Binary 00011000, 11011000, 10111100

Shades and Tints of #18d8bc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000404 is the darkest color, while #f2fef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#18d8bc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747c7b is the less saturated color, while #06eac9 is the most saturated one.
